Reviewers should note that batch size and flush interval interact: larger batches reduce write amplification against the suppression store, but lengthen the window during which a hard-bounced address can still receive mail. The retry ceiling exists because some providers replay webhooks aggressively. Any change to these values requires a matching update to the alert thresholds. The current defaults are listed below.

tuning table, yajog-yahof:
BUDGETS = {
    "lamvan": 303,
    "wenox": 460,
    "fenvan": 525,
}

Subject: Quickstore 4.2 — bloom filter now fronts the KV layer

Plugin authors: starting with this release, Quickstore places a bloom filter ahead of the key-value store. Negative lookups return faster; false positives fall through safely. No API changes are required on your side. Verify your plugin against the staging build referenced below.

session token of fahif-tadup = htk3_9c7

# Artifact Signing: Sweepstake

Quick refresher for the sync: Sweepstake, our orphaned-resource sweeper, now requires signed artifacts before the Hollowpine scheduler will run it. Yes, even dry-run builds. The pipeline handles this automatically on tagged releases, but if you're hand-rolling a build for the staging sweep, you'll need to sign it yourself. Verification failures land in the sweeper-alerts channel, so don't wing it. For local signing, use the team release key below.

rollout seal: bky4_x7Gc